Book excerpt: This publication the first in a new series of profiles of health and well-being presents an analysis of the state of and trends in health in Greece. Although Greece had been among the countries with the best health status in the WHO European Region health improvements were falling behind those in other countries that belonged to the European Union before May 2004 (EU15) well before the current economic crisis and progress towards the targets of the Health 2020 policy framework is mixed. Historically the Greek population has been one of the healthiest in Europe. As a result of the continuing economic crisis the widening gap in health status and the absence of national health policies aligned with Health 2020 inequalities are likely to increase and progress towards and achievement of Health 2020 goals might be jeopardized unless decisive proactive measures are taken soon. Book excerpt: This publication the second in a new series of profiles of health and well-being presents an analysis of the state of and trends in health in Slovenia. While improvements in life expectancy and mortality in the country have been rapid since 2000 the most recent rates remain below the average for the countries belonging to the European Union (EU) before 1 May 2004 (EU15). Declining infant and maternal mortality rates are driving these improvements in life expectancy in conjunction with decreasing mortality rates from diseases of the circulatory system infectious diseases diseases of the respiratory system and diseases of the genitourinary system. Motor vehicle traffic accident deaths have also decreased rapidly in recent years. In contrast mortality from cancer and diseases of the digestive system especially chronic liver disease and cirrhosis is higher in Slovenia than the average for the WHO European Region. Improved trends have been observed for 12 out of the 19 core indicators for the targets of the Health 2020 policy in Europe and deteriorating trends have been noted for four: alcohol consumption per capita prevalence of overweight the unemployment rate and private household out-of-pocket expenditure on health services.
